SPECS THAT ACTUALLY MATTER

GRINDER
A good burr grinder improves coffee more than any other upgrade. Steel conical burrs are the baseline.
THERMOBLOCK
Fast warm-up but less stable than a boiler — fine for most home use.
PODS
Pod systems cost €0.35–0.80 per cup vs €0.15–0.25 for beans — we compute your 5-year difference.
MAINTENANCE
Automatic milk systems need daily cleaning. Ignoring this is the #1 reliability complaint.

COMMON BUYING MISTAKES

  • Paying for 19-bar claims — 9 bars is the extraction standard
  • Buying a milk system you won't clean daily
  • Underestimating pod costs over five years
  • Choosing features over grinder quality

CATEGORY QUESTIONS

Bean-to-cup or pod machine?

Bean-to-cup wins on per-cup cost and taste ceiling; pods win on convenience. We show the 5-year cost of both paths for your consumption.

Does pump pressure matter?

No — extraction happens at ~9 bars regardless of the 15–19 bar pump rating. It's the most abused spec in coffee marketing.

How much maintenance is realistic?

Descaling every 1–3 months, weekly brew-group rinsing, daily milk-system cleaning if fitted. The report flags models where this burden is high.
